Mesothelioma Litigation

In some cases, defendants may try to reduce a mesothelioma settlement amount. An attorney can appeal the decision to win compensation for you.

Most personal injury mesothelioma lawsuits are based on a claim for compensation for pain and suffering. Families of victims who have suffered mesothelioma-related death, or another asbestos-related illness, can file wrongful death claims.

Find out where and how you were exposed

Mesothelioma can be a fatal illness caused by asbestos exposure. A mesothelioma suit will allow victims to recover compensation for medical expenses, pain, and suffering. Compensation may also compensate for lost income and other financial difficulties.

Mesothelioma lawsuits seek to hold the manufacturers accountable for the exposure that resulted in the diagnosis. The goal is to get an enormous settlement to pay the cost of mesothelioma treatment.

An experienced mesothelioma law firm can help victims and their loved ones pursue legal action against the negligent companies that put profits ahead of safety. Most lawsuits are filed within a state or federal court system that is favorable to mesothelioma cases. The court process starts with a free assessment of your case by a mesothelioma attorney.

During the initial interview during the initial interview, the lawyer will ask victims about their mesothelioma diagnosis as well as how they came into contact with asbestos. Patients must be prepared for the interview since they may not be able to answer all questions or recall everything.

The mesothelioma attorneys will conduct a thorough investigation to determine the source of the exposure. A mesothelioma attorney will review medical records and other evidence to create an exhaustive account of the victim's exposure to asbestos.

The mesothelioma attorneys will also research asbestos trust funds to find the best possible settlement options for their clients. The mesothelioma attorneys will ensure that settlements are appropriate and adequate for their clients to be on the path to recovery. A mesothelioma legal team will be ready to fight for every penny of compensation that victims are entitled to receive.

Cast a Broad Net

Mesothelioma is a rare condition that is often caused by asbestos exposure. The disease typically manifests 10 to 40 years after the first exposure. A mesothelioma diagnose suggests that the patient was exposed to asbestos at some point in their lives. He or she may be entitled to compensation from the people responsible.

Mesothelioma patients have the time to file a lawsuit to recover damages. The time limit for filing a lawsuit varies from state to state but it is usually when the patient is "on notice" that they might have a claim against the companies who exposed them.

A mesothelioma attorney who is experienced can assist victims in filing an injury claim or wrongful death lawsuit. These lawsuits are filed to seek compensation from firms that exposed victims. They could also ask for punitive damages.

Although there is no cure for Mesothelioma cancer treatment options may help prolong the duration of survival. A successful mesothelioma lawsuit could help patients and their loved ones live longer, receive better medical treatment and reduce the financial burden resulting from the disease.

Mesothelioma claims can be filed as a class action lawsuit or as an individual claim. In the case of a class action lawsuit that includes plaintiffs from all over the world file their cases against only one defendant. Individual mesothelioma cases are filed against a variety of companies who exposed the patient asbestos. They could be more complex than a typical class-action case. Individual lawsuits are often resolved faster and are more likely to receive larger settlement amounts than a class action lawsuit.

Find a fair settlement

Asbestos victims typically face high-cost medical bills and lost earnings, which is why it is crucial that they secure compensation from asbestos producers who are responsible. In a mesothelioma-related case, victims can claim damages for physical emotional, financial and mental suffering.

A mesothelioma attorney will prepare the necessary paperwork following a determination of the validity of the case. This will include the mesothelioma patient's diagnosis and evidence of their exposure to. Attorneys will determine which court system is the best to file in since certain states have laws more favorable for mesothelioma.

After the case is filed, it will be moved into a negotiation process between the legal team and the asbestos trust fund or the company. The process could last several months or even years based on the complexity. mesothelioma law firms settlements can amount to more than $1 million. This can help victims cover living expenses and provide life-changing financial assistance for their families.

If a plaintiff's mesothelioma case doesn't settle the patient or their family could decide to go to trial. This will permit them to expose the defendants to scrutiny and receive higher awards although trials are usually long and can be a challenge to navigate.

It's important to keep in mind that regardless of any final award, the money paid to asbestos-related victims is usually not taxable. This is because the IRS considers these payouts to be compensation for a disease, not as income tax-deductible. It is essential to speak with a mesothelioma attorney to ensure the proper tax exemptions are in place for all payments received. A top mesothelioma attorney will defend their client's rights throughout the whole process.

Trials are held

Asbestos companies want to avoid trials as much as they can, since a verdict could cost them a lot of money. This is because defendants would be required to pay more for the victims and their families than they could afford. A mesothelioma claim verdict which is accepted by a jury may be appealed in the future which could increase the cost and decrease the amount of compensation paid by victims.

While the majority of cases settle some mesothelioma lawsuits go to trial. Trials can last several years, adding up to more than a decade of litigation for certain victims. Your lawyer will try to settle the matter in the shortest time possible and only take your case to trial when necessary to get a fair verdict.

Mesothelioma lawsuits are complex and involve many different parties. The number of defendants could influence the settlement amount. Each defendant can contribute to the total settlement of the victim, since they all share the responsibility. The financial resources of the defendants as well as their insurance coverage are also considered.

The compensation of the plaintiff may comprise non-economic damages, which include medical expenses including pain and suffering, as well as lost income. The amount of these damages varies depending on the jurisdiction. A wrongful death lawsuit could also seek punitive damages in order to punish the defendant for any wrongdoing.

It is important to note that the majority of mesothelioma attorneys work on a contingent fee basis which means that they don't charge fees up upfront and only get paid when the case is settled or awarded in court. A majority of attorneys also have a contract in writing with their clients that they will pay them for any out of expense expenses. These expenses usually comprise depositions or copies documents.
